Felicia mercilessly shattered Maurice's fantasy. "It wasn't for you. I would've done the same for anyone. And Maurice, I won't be grateful for the sacrifices you made for me. You and me are even once I get rid of the venomous creature in your body."

Maurice was living in a delusion, and Felicia's bluntness was enough to break any lingering sentiment.

His smile froze. His gaze sharpened, locking onto Felicia's face. For a moment, his expression was laced with frustration. But in the end, all that remained was resignation. "Did you have to put it that bluntly?"

Felicia shrugged. "I was just speaking the truth."

He was speechless. He lowered his eyes, concealing the turmoil in them. The momentary daze made his tall figure seem lonely and desolate.

To be fair, Maurice was handsome. His sharp features were sharp yet tinged with an unnatural allure. When he was arrogant, there was an intimidating air about him. But now, he looked almost pitiful.

Unfortunately, he was dealing with Felicia.

She packed up her needle kit, not sparing him another glance. "Alright, get some rest. We set sail first thing in the morning."

With that, she turned to leave.

Maurice finally spoke, his voice barely above a whisper. Felicia might not have even heard him if the room wasn't so quiet. "I did this of my own will. From the very start, I never expected you to be grateful. And I don't need your pity. I just… didn't want you to get hurt. That's all."

A gust of wind blew in from the window, scattering his words into the air.
